> If the POSIX standard is going to require backreferences, then it should also require a non-backtracking implementation for regular expressions without backreferences
At least in some regexp engines, this is possible. There is a concept of possessive (as opposed to reluctant, or as it's often called, "non-greedy") quantifiers. Given the string "abb", consider the following regexes:
/[ab]+b/ -- matches "abb"
/[ab]+?b/ -- matches "ab"
/[ab]++b/ -- DOES NOT MATCH!! (Because there is no back-tracking.)
